On the former site of the South Central Farm Construction of a warehouse facility and distribution center with approximately 643,000 square feet of warehouse and ancillary support space in a 46-foot high, two-story structure on a 10.04 acres site (437,196 square feet after dedication) in the M2-2 Zone. The project includes subterranean parking of approximately 114,399 square feet for 306 cars. Parking for another 39 cars would be provided at grade level for a total of 345 parking spaces.

Former Santa Monica Green Mayor Mike Feinstein speaks against approving a warehouse on the land of the South Central Farm, and the conflict such approval would have with the Los Angeles General Plan Framework, at the City of Los Angeles Hearing Agenda - Subdivisions, July 2nd, 2008.

Linda Piera-Avila (County Councilmember, Green Party of Los Angeles County) speaks against approving a warehouse on the land of the South Central Farm, and the negative air quality impacts it would have, at the City of Los Angeles Hearing Agenda - Subdivisions, July 2nd, 2008.
